      Qatar VS Switzerland Switzerland is a top - tier European team, with an edge in both strength and form. The team is ranked 19th in the FIFA rankings, and the total value of the squad is 332 million euros, 16 times that of Qatar. In the World Cup qualifiers, they had an unbeaten record of 4 wins and 2 draws in 6 games, conceding only 2 goals. Their defense is among the best in Europe. In recent friendlies, they achieved 4 wins and 2 draws. They thrashed Jordan 4 - 1 and drew 1 - 1 with Australia, showing smooth offensive and defensive operations. The starting lineup led by Granit Xhaka and Manuel Akanji all come from the top five European leagues. They have strict tactical discipline and are efficient in counter - attacks.       Qatar VS Switzerland Qatar typically employs a 4-2-3-1 formation. The players have developed a strong understanding through long - term participation in matches together. On the field, they first try to advance the ball through short passes in the midfield. Afif is in charge of cutting in from the wing and initiating passes, while Almoez Ali is responsible for scoring in the penalty area by seizing opportunities. The double - holding midfielders are tasked with both distributing the ball from the back and performing light interceptions. After losing the ball, they conduct local counter - presses to force the opponents into hasty passes. A common scoring method is to use the near - post flick on set - pieces. However, the team has obvious weaknesses. The players have relatively weak physical confrontation abilities. When faced with high - intensity close - marking, their ball - holding stability declines.
